How I live my faith

I love this Church and the Gospel of Jesus Christ. In the Church, we have opportunities to serve our members as well as to others not of our faith. At the moment, I am a ward missionary. That means that I work with some of the Church's full-time missionaries as well as others in our ward (congregation) to spread the Gospel. It is a great and fun way to serve. I go to a singles ward which is a congregation for young single adults. There is a very spiritual atmosphere there. Also, one Sunday a month, I teach some of the single men in our ward. It is usually a basic lesson on gospel principles (like faith, prayer, etc) but there is always something we can learn from those basic topics. I enjoy helping others and doing my part to help the Gospel move forward.
